Simulations of V-I characteristics in a plasma focus fun
1992
IEEE Transactions on Plasma Science
he voltage (V) and current (I) characteristics in a plasma focus gun are simulated to yield the current efficiency and the rundown velocity of the current sheath. Since the discharge circuit is strongly influenced by the rundown dynamics of the current sheath, the simple snowplow model, which is modified to include the time-varying current and mass efficiencies, f and k, respectively, is employed. The computer simulations are carried out for two separate experiments using deuterium and argon
